TOPSHAM RUGBY FOOTBALL CLUB 

The objects of the Club are to promote community participation in healthy recreation by providing facilities for playing rugby union football and other sports which involve physical or mental skill or exertion; and to provide or assist in the provision of facilities for sport, recreation or other leisure time occupation of such persons who have need for such facilities.

Co-Operative Group - Grant to Topsham Rugby Football Club
£1,923 23/10/2021
We would like to purchase a waste management system to allow us to offer camping facilities over the summer months. This will bring additional tourists into our town, supporting many local businesses.
Sport England - COVID-19 CEF
£9,000 26/05/2020
4
Funding under Sport England's COVID-19 Community Emergency Fund funding programme for a Revenue project titled COVID-19 CEF. This project lists its main activity as Rugby Union
